Main sandy beach area in the newer part of town, popular for swimming, promenades, and classic views of Monterosso’s seafront.
The historic centre’s narrow lanes and small squares give a strong sense of local life, with churches, old houses, and easy sea access.
Scenic footpath linking Monterosso and Vernazza through terraces and coastal viewpoints. A classic walk for active visitors.
Anchovies from Monterosso, often salted or marinated. They are a local hallmark thanks to the village’s long fishing tradition.
A warm seafood salad of octopus, potatoes, olives and herbs. Common along the Ligurian coast and rooted in local fishing cuisine.
Ligurian focaccia topped simply with olive oil and salt. A daily staple in the region, eaten as a snack, breakfast or alongside meals.

More expensive than many Italian small towns due to Cinque Terre demand. Hotels, seafood meals and summer transport cost more, though simple lunches and trains can still be manageable.
Service is often included or covered by coperto, so tipping is modest. Round up or leave 5-10% for very good restaurant service; taxis can be rounded up, and cafés just small change.
